Izinto ezilungileyo ze-axial flow turbine
Xa kuthelekiswa nee turbines zikaFrancis, ii-axial flow turbines zineenzuzo eziphambili zilandelayo:
1. Isantya esiphezulu esithile kunye neempawu ezintle zamandla. Ke ngoko, isantya seyunithi kunye nokuhamba kweyunithi kuphezulu kunelo lomoya we-Francis. Ngaphantsi kwentloko efanayo yamanzi kunye neemeko zemveliso, inokunciphisa kakhulu ubungakanani beyunithi yejeneretha ye-turbine, ukunciphisa ubunzima beyunithi, kunye nokugcina ukusetyenziswa kwezinto eziphathekayo, ngoko kuqoqosho. phezulu.
2. Ubume bomphezulu kunye noburhabaxa bomphezulu weblade yembaleki ye-axial flow turbine inokuhlangabezana ngokulula neemfuno kwimveliso. Ngenxa yokuba iibhlewudi ze-axial-flow rotary-paddle turbine zinokujikeleza, umndilili wokusebenza kakuhle uphezulu kunalowo we-mixed-flow turbine. Xa umthwalo kunye nentloko yamanzi iguquka, ukusebenza kakuhle akutshintshi kakhulu.
3. Iibhulethi zomgijimi we-axial-flow paddle turbine ziyakwazi ukuchithwa, ezilungele ukuveliswa kunye nokuthutha.
Ke ngoko, i-axial flow turbine inokugcina uzinzo kuluhlu olukhulu lokusebenza, kunye nokungcangcazela okuncinci, kunye nokusebenza okuphezulu kunye nesiphumo. Kuluhlu olunentloko ephantsi, iphantse yathatha indawo ye-Francis turbine. Kumashumi eminyaka akutshanje, zombini ngokubhekiselele kwiyunithi enye kunye nokusetyenziswa kwentloko yamanzi, kukho uphuhliso olukhulu, kwaye ukusetyenziswa kwayo kubanzi kakhulu.
Ukungalungi kwe-axial flow turbine
Nangona kunjalo, i-axial flow turbine ineziphene kwaye iyanciphisa umda wosetyenziso. Ezona ntsilelo ziphambili zezi:
1. Inani lee-blades lincinci, kwaye liyi-cantilever, ngoko amandla ahluphekile, kwaye akanakusetyenziswa kwizikhululo zamanzi aphakathi kunye aphezulu.
2. Ngenxa yomlinganiselo wokuhamba kweyunithi enkulu kunye nesantya esiphezulu seyunithi, inobude obuncinci bokufunxa kune-Francis turbine phantsi kwemeko yentloko efanayo, okukhokelela kubunzulu obukhulu bokumbiwa kwesiseko sesikhululo samandla kunye notyalo-mali oluphezulu.
Ngokweziphene ezikhankanywe ngasentla ze-axial flow turbines, izixhobo ezitsha zokulwa ne-anti-cavitation zisetyenziselwa ukuveliswa kwee-turbine kunye nokunyanzeliswa kwee-blades kuphuculwe kuyilo, ukwenzela ukuba intloko yesicelo se-axial flow turbines iphuculwe ngokuqhubekayo. Okwangoku, intloko yesicelo se-axial-flow paddle turbine yi-3 ukuya kwi-90 m, kwaye ingene kwindawo ye-Francis turbine. Umzekelo, ubuninzi beyunithi ephumayo ye-axial-flow paddle turbines yangaphandle yi-181,700 kW, ubuninzi bentloko yamanzi yi-88m, kwaye i-diameter yembaleki yi-10.3m. Ubuninzi bemveliso yomatshini omnye we-axial-flow paddle turbine eveliswe kwilizwe lam yi-175,000 kW, ubuninzi bentloko yamanzi yi-78m, kwaye i-diameter ye-mbaleki ephezulu yi-11.3m. I-axial-flow fixed-propeller turbine ine-blades esisigxina kunye nesakhiwo esilula, kodwa ayikwazi ukuziqhelanisa nezikhululo zombane we-hydropower kunye neenguqu ezinkulu kwintloko yamanzi kunye nomthwalo. Inentloko yamanzi ezinzileyo kwaye isebenza njengomthwalo osisiseko okanye isikhululo samandla esinezixa ezininzi. Xa amandla onyaka ebuninzi, uthelekiso lwezoqoqosho lunokwenzeka. Inokuqwalaselwa. Uluhlu lwentloko olusebenzayo luyi-3-50m. Iiiturbines ze-axial-flow paddle zisebenzisa izixhobo ezithe nkqo. Inkqubo yokusebenza kwayo ngokusisiseko iyafana naleyo yee turbines zikaFrancis. Umahluko kukuba xa umthwalo uguquka, awugcini nje ukulawula ukujikeleza kwee-vanes zesikhokelo. , Ngoxa kwakhona ulungelelanisa ukujikeleza kwee-blades zomgijimi ukugcina ukusebenza kakuhle.
